The musical heritage of India
The origins of Indian classical music can be found in the beliefs of its people, tradition dating back to the Neolithic period. According to Indian mythology, this is the music that Brahma created the universe. First feature: Indian music is not written. Indeed, in the past, it should be forwarded to the disciples, and stored in memory, not on paper. Indian classical music relies so heavily on improvisation around ragas (musical sketch). Another major difference, the Indian scale is divided into 22 intervals when the West has only 12.
Dances
India offers a number of classical dances related to religion, like music. There are different schools for each regional style. Thus, we can iter Kathakali of Kerala that combines theater, music and dance to tell the great episodes from mythology. Dance forms are varied dances of temples such as Bharatnatyam, Odissi, Mohiniyattam and symbolizes the victory of good over evil. Kathak and Kuchipudi are religious and mythological tales to the accompaniment music, mime and dance. Finally, the Manipuri Raas Dandiya and happy love story of Radha and Krishna.
